Maars Residential AdvisorTexas State Technical College May 2022 - Jul 2023Harlingen, Texas, United StatesDuring summers '22 and '23, I was a Residential Advisor for the Migrant Academic Achievement Residential Summer (MAARS) program at Texas State Technical College. The MAARS program was designed to empower high school migrant and seasonal farmworkers in their pursuit of higher education and community service, MAARS offered opportunities for personal and educational growth. Throughout the program, my role involved:-Providing individualized support to students, guiding them through academic challenges and personal development. -Facilitating meaningful group sessions and one-on-one meetings to offer guidance, mentorship, and encouragement.-Mediating conflicts between residents, fostering a harmonious and supportive community environment.-Actively participating in weekly field trips, enriching the educational experience and strengthening community connections.My experience with MAARS was deeply rewarding, allowing me to make a positive impact on the lives of students and contribute to their journey towards academic success and personal fulfillment. -
